AEP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

1,083 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in American Electric Power (AEP)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$26.7B — up 4.6% from $25.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 174 funds opened new AEP positions and 83 closed out — a net gain of 91 holders — while 337 added to existing stakes and 360 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, adding an estimated $260M. The largest seller was Massachusetts Financial Services, cutting an estimated $137M.
